Jet.AI launches national jet card programme
The programme offers all categories of private jet for service within the continental US, guaranteed rates and availability, plus a 48 hour call out. An optional escrow is also included, and only 44 peak days.

Jet.AI has officially launched its national jet card programme, which offers all categories of private jet for service within the continental US, guaranteed rates, guaranteed availability and a 48 hour call out. Programme highlights include an optional escrow, and only 44 peak days (below the industry average of 47).

"Building on our successful regional jet card programme, we're excited to enter the national market with a new and thoughtfully constructed offering," says executive chairman and interim CEO Mike Winston. "We're particularly enthusiastic about the escrow option, which offers peace of mind to jet card buyers through our relationship with third party administrator Avitrust. More than half of all jet card buyers already have regular access to a private jet so in addition to its own profitable characteristics, the jet card product can lead to the cross-sale of charter, fraction and brokerage."
